Difference between inner join and outer join pdf
File Name: difference between inner join and outer join .zip
- SQL Joins Tutorial: Cross Join, Full Outer Join, Inner Join, Left Join, and Right Join.
- Difference Between Inner Join and Outer Join in SQL
- Join (SQL)
This option follows the name of the table and precedes any alias declaration. The effect of this option is that rows are selected only from the listed partitions or subpartitions.
SQL Joins Tutorial: Cross Join, Full Outer Join, Inner Join, Left Join, and Right Join.
Joins allow us to re-construct our separated database tables back into the relationships that power our applications. Spoiler alert : we'll cover five different types—but you really only need to know two of them! Before we look at how to write the join itself, let's look at what the result of a join would look like. We could write separate queries to retrieve both the user information and the address information—but ideally we could write one query and receive all of the users and their addresses in the same result set. We'll look at how to write these joins soon, but if we joined our user information to our address information we could get a result like this:. Besides producing a combined result set, another important use of joins is to pull extra information into our query that we can filter against. For example, if we wanted to send some physical mail to all users who live in Oklahoma City, we could use this joined-together result set and filter based on the city column.
Difference Between Inner Join and Outer Join in SQL
In practical scenarios, whenever we make use of DBMS, we deal with multiple database tables. Actually, in most cases, we need to combinedly work on these tables. We have to use the combined result of these tables for more operations. So in this blog, we will learn what is a join clause and the various types of the join along with examples. We will take all the examples in this blog using the MySQL database only. In DBMS, a join statement is mainly used to combine two tables based on a specified common field between them. If we talk in terms of Relational algebra, it is the cartesian product of two tables followed by the selection operation.
ON; is used when join column names are different [1,2]. Every type of these inner join types has its own conditions, but the question is: If there is a query that.
Join Stack Overflow to learn, share knowledge, and build your career. Connect and share knowledge within a single location that is structured and easy to search. I understand the working of inner and outer joins.
Inner Join and Outer Join both are the types of Join. Join compares and combines tuples from two relations or tables.
You can download this cheat sheet as follows:. JOIN typically combines rows with equal values for the specified columns. Such columns are foreign keys. The JOIN condition is the equality between the primary key columns in one table and columns referring to them in the other table. There is also another, older syntax, but it isn't recommended. The JOIN condition doesn't have to be an equality — it can be any condition you want.
Identical values of the key attributes indicate matching Examples. An Attribute with id role is selected as key by default but an arbitrary set of one or more Attributes can be chosen as key. Four types of joins are possible: inner , left , right and outer join. All these types of joins are explained in the parameters section. Therefore all input ExampleSet need to have the same structure number of Attributes, Attribute names and value types. Both resulting ExampleSets are delivered as output of the Superset Operator.
- Имея партнера в Америке, Танкадо мог разделить два ключа географически. Возможно, это хорошо продуманный ход.